<p style="text-align: justify;"><span data-contrast="auto">Currently, it is not diseases that are of the biggest concern in the Vannamei shrimp industry in SE Asia and the Indian subcontinent.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></p><p style="text-align: justify;"><span data-contrast="auto">Perhaps yes, for some in smaller locations, but this is more down to poor management principles.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></p><p style="text-align: justify;"><span data-contrast="auto">A simple look at the price trends of shrimp indicates that when diseases are rampant, then shrimp prices go up. Right now, prices are low.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></p><p style="text-align: justify;"><span data-contrast="auto">No - the biggest issue facing Indian farmers is the selling price paid! </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></p><p style="text-align: justify;"><span data-contrast="auto">Prices will come down further on the commodity - a volume play. With Ecuador looking to produce 1.5MMT in 2023 and able to sell with the lowest prices on the market, this adds extra pressure for finding a home for domestic production. Ecuador also has the potential to ramp up to a much higher volume output over time - so look out rest-of-the-world.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></p><p style="text-align: justify;"><span data-contrast="auto">To this end, India must harness its 1.4bn population to support the local domestic consumption of farmed shrimp.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></p><p style="text-align: justify;"><span data-contrast="auto">Shrimp is a healthy, cheap protein source, and a local generic shrimp marketing program supported by the Indian government would not go amiss.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></p><p style="text-align: justify;"><span data-contrast="auto">&nbsp;</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></p><h2 style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: 14pt;" data-contrast="auto">Innovations in Shrimp Industry</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></h2><p style="text-align: justify;">&nbsp;</p><p style="text-align: justify;"><span data-contrast="auto">Shrimp-specific food service restaurants, as are e-commerce shrimp-to-home delivery systems, are starting to appear.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></p><p style="text-align: justify;"><span data-contrast="auto">Innovations like the steamans.com VapTap v.3 unit healthily steam cooks from frozen raw shrimp and addresses safe food storage and final delivery - sterilizing the shrimp on the spot for the end consumer - a possible food safety concern in India.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></p><p style="text-align: justify;"><span data-contrast="auto">The rapidly growing shrimp export industry is under pressure, and pivoting some energy to domesticate sales would not go amiss currently.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}">&nbsp;</span></p><p style="text-align: justify;">&nbsp;</p><p style="text-align: justify;">&nbsp;</p><p style="text-align: justify;">&nbsp;</p><p style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: 10pt;"><em>This article was contributed by our expert <a href="https://www.linkedin.com/in/aquafood/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">Patrick Wood</a>&nbsp;</em></span></p><p style="text-align: justify;">&nbsp;</p><p style="text-align: justify;">&nbsp;</p><h3 style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: 18pt;">Frequently Asked Questions Answered by Patrick Wood &nbsp;</span></h3><h3 style="text-align: justify;">&nbsp;</h3><h2 style="text-align: justify;"><span style="font-size: 12pt;">1.
